Crimson Cliffs was not able to break out of their rough patch on Thursday as the team picked up their fifth straight loss. The contest between them and the Desert Hills Thunder didn't end well, with the Crimson Cliffs Mustangs falling 62-47. The Mustangs were not able to repeat the success they had when they faced the Thunder earlier this season, when they won 51-49.

Crimson Cliffs' defeat came despite a true team effort from the offense, with many players turning in solid performances. Perhaps the best among them was Jayda Alofipo, who posted ten points and five steals. Those five steals gave Alofipo a new career-high. Another player making a difference was Josie Myers, who put up 16 points and seven rebounds.
Crimson Cliffs' loss dropped their record down to 4-13. As for Desert Hills, their win was their third straight on the road, which pushed their record up to 11-7.
Both teams will have to hit the road in their upcoming games. Crimson Cliffs has already played their next matchup (against Dixie), but no score has been uploaded at the time of writing. Desert Hills won't have much time to rest: their next game is against Hurricane at 7:00 p.m. on Friday. Desert Hills has been dominant on offense recently, having racked up an incredible 186 points over their last three contests.
